Bumpy LWM?

Featured Replies

I have moved the shorelines and roads in my scenery, but I'm getting some not so good results.The LWM makes squares and when I try to place roads where I have moved the land it looks very bumpy :-(Is there any way around this or do I need to move the roads ?

Hi knnygar.Is this remeshed land? and if so, have you altered this FS2002.cfg line?TERRAIN_MAX_VERTEX_LEVEL=19Dick

Yes, this is remeshed land.I have not changed this value TERRAIN_MAX_VERTEX_LEVEL=19, what should it be?

Hi knnygar.It should stay at 19! Moving it up to 21, as some mesh makers would like really messes up the terrain in remeshed areas.Something you might try:Right on the roadline, you could make 2 point transparent flattens. The problem is the road slopes, so the flatten "lines' would need to be 'stepped' with small elevation changes.It's too bad MS did not leave us a way to return to the default mesh, after a flatten is used. Hopefully in FS2004 ( and hopefully they will not use the awful terrain engine of CFS3! ).Dick
